How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Northeast Philadelphia?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Northeast Philadelphia Studio Apartments | $993 | $600 | $1,888 |
Northeast Philadelphia 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,375 | $800 | $2,500 |
| Northeast Philadelphia 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,747 | $825 | $2,850 |
| Northeast Philadelphia 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,714 | $1,300 | $2,600 |
| Northeast Philadelphia 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,873 | $1,556 | $2,229 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Northeast Philadelphia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Northeast Philadelphia with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Northeast Philadelphia is at Manchester Apartments listed at $895.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Northeast Philadelphia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Northeast Philadelphia is $1,375.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Northeast Philadelphia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Northeast Philadelphia is a 1,401 square feet unit starting from $2,200 at Hunters Glen.
What is the average size for Northeast Philadelphia 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Northeast Philadelphia is currently 938 sq ft.
